Number Of New Trump-Themed Malicious Tokens Spike 206% After Official Memecoin Launch

The ongoing TRUMP memecoin frenzy has sparked the creation of hundreds of tokens inspired by the US president and his family. A recent report revealed malicious tokens and dApps using Donald Trump references skyrocketed since Friday, targeting unsuspected investors and non-crypto people. Trump-Themed Scams Skyrocket Over the weekend, US President Donald Trump surprised the crypto industry by launching his official memecoin, TRUMP. The token received heavy criticism, with several crypto investors calling the Presidents memecoin venture a big red flag. Many community members initially suspected the token was a hacking scam, while others expressed reservations about TRUMPs tokenomics. Regardless of the doubts, the memecoin eclipsed the market, skyrocketing to $30 in a few hours and hitting an all-time high (ATH) of $75 a day later. Web3 security platform Blockaid shared that TRUMPs successful launch also ignited a rapid proliferation of malicious tokens, fake dApps, and scams using the Trump name and branding, following the trend of scammers leveraging major news events in the crypto industry to target unsuspecting users. According to the report, tokens with the Trump name increased by 206% on the launch day. The report stated, Many of these tokens used misleading branding to lure investors. The chart shows that since late December, the number of new malicious tokens with the word Trump has hovered between 2,000 and 3,000 daily. However, this number increased to 6,800 tokens deployed on Friday, double the usual 3,300 Trump-inspired tokens created daily. Additionally, the number of fake dApps deployed saw record rates over the weekend. The malicious applications are often used to trick users into connecting their wallets, allowing scammers to drain funds. Blockaid reports that impersonator dApps using President Trumps name saw a 14x increase after the launch, with 91 malicious dApps deployed in 24 hours. Trump Memecoin Frenzy Continues The report highlighted that scammers didnt stop at Trump-themed tokens. Memecoins with metadata referencing the Trump family, including Melania and Barron-inspired ones, surged by 592% over the weekend, creating the illusion of an interconnected ecosystem. Its worth noting that US First Lady Melania Trump announced the launch of her official memecoin, MELANIA, on Sunday afternoon. The launch pushed the crypto market to a 6% correction, with Bitcoin (BTC) dropping below $100,000, and TRUMP declining 49% in an hour. On Inauguration Day, DexScreeners main page showed a plethora of memecoins inspired by the Trump Family. Of the top 15 tokens, 11 were related to the presidential family, including the official TRUMP and MELANIA memecoins. Fake Donald Trump Jr, Ivanka, and Eric memecoins were also launched, alongside Trump-related figures like US Vice President JC Vance and Elon Musk. Despite the several Musk-themed tokens already existing, the recently launched memecoins used branding inspired by the official Trump tokens. A video shared on X shows that during Trumps inauguration speech, community members created several new tokens themed after the speech. Users flooded the market with dozens of memecoins using phrases like Make America respected again or America will be admired again just seconds after the US President pronounced them, potentially attempting to lucre from the ongoing hype. Certik Uncovers Security Vulnerability in Worldcoin’s Verification Process

On May 29, 2023, Certik, a blockchain and smart contract auditing firm, reported a critical security vulnerability within Worldcoin’s verification process. This flaw could have allowed attackers to bypass strict identification measures and operate an Orb, a device used to collect users’ iris information.
